catalog.explicit_object_permissions (base de données SSISDB)catalog.explicit_object_permissions (SSISDB Database)

CETTE RUBRIQUE S’APPLIQUE À : ouiSQL Server (à partir de la version 2012)nonAzure SQL DatabasenonAzure SQL Data WarehousenonParallel Data Warehouse THIS TOPIC APPLIES TO: yesSQL Server (starting with 2012)noAzure SQL DatabasenoAzure SQL Data Warehouse noParallel Data Warehouse

Affiche uniquement les autorisations affectées explicitement à l'utilisateur.Displays only the permissions that have been explicitly assigned to the user.

Nom de colonneColumn name Type de donnéesData type DescriptionDescription
object_typeobject_type smallintsmallint Type d'objet sécurisable.The type of securable object. Les types d'objets sécurisables incluent le dossier (1), le projet (2), l'environnement (3) et l'opération (4).Securable objects types include folder (1), project (2), environment (3), and operation (4).
object_idobject_id bigintbigint Identificateur unique (ID) ou clé primaire de l'objet sécurisé.The unique identifier (ID) or primary key of the secured object.
principal_idprincipal_id intint ID du principal de base de données.The ID of the database principal.
permission_typepermission_type smallintsmallint Type de l'autorisation.The type of permission.
is_denyis_deny bitbit Indique si l'autorisation a été refusée ou accordée.Indicates whether the permission has been denied or granted. Lorsque la valeur est 1, l'autorisation a été refusée.When the value is 1, the permission has been denied. Lorsque la valeur est 0, l'autorisation n'a pas été refusée.When the value is 0, the permission has not been denied.
grantor_idgrantor_id intint ID du principal qui a accordé l'autorisation.The ID of the principal who granted the permission.

NotesRemarks

Cette vue affiche les types d'autorisation répertoriés dans le tableau suivant :This view displays the permission types listed in the following table:

Valeur permission_typepermission_type Value Nom de l'autorisationPermission Name Description de l'autorisationPermission Description Types d'objet applicablesApplicable Object Types
1 READREAD Permet au principal de lire des informations considérées comme faisant partie de l'objet, telles que les propriétés.Allows the principal to read information that is considered part of the object, such as properties. Il n'autorise pas le principal à énumérer ou à lire le contenu d'autres objets contenus dans l'objet.It does not allow the principal to enumerate or read the contents of other objects contained within the object. Dossier, projet, environnement, opérationFolder, Project, Environment, Operation
2 MODIFYMODIFY Permet au principal de modifier des informations considérées comme faisant partie de l'objet, telles que les propriétés.Allows the principal to modify information that is considered part of the object, such as properties. Il ne permet pas au principal de modifier d'autres objets contenus dans l'objet.It does not allow the principal to modify other objects contained within the object. Dossier, projet, environnement, opérationFolder, Project, Environment, Operation
3 ExécutezEXECUTE Permet au principal d'exécuter tous les packages dans le projet.Allows the principal to execute all packages in the project. ProjetProject
4 MANAGE_PERMISSIONSMANAGE_PERMISSIONS Permet au principal d'affecter des autorisations aux objets.Allows the principal to assign permissions to the objects. Dossier, projet, environnement, opérationFolder, Project, Environment, Operation
100 CREATE_OBJECTSCREATE_OBJECTS Permet au principal de créer des objets dans le dossier.Allows the principal to create objects in the folder. DossierFolder
101 READ_OBJECTSREAD_OBJECTS Permet au principal de lire tous les objets dans le dossier.Allows the principal to read all objects in the folder. DossierFolder
102 MODIFY_OBJECTSMODIFY_OBJECTS Permet au principal de modifier tous les objets dans le dossier.Allows the principal to modify all objects in the folder. DossierFolder
103 EXECUTE_OBJECTSEXECUTE_OBJECTS Permet au principal d'exécuter tous les packages de tous les projets dans le dossier.Allows the principal to execute all packages from all projects in the folder. DossierFolder
104 MANAGE_OBJECT_PERMISSIONSMANAGE_OBJECT_PERMISSIONS Permet au principal de gérer des autorisations sur tous les objets dans le dossier.Allows the principal to manage permissions on all objects in the folder. DossierFolder

PermissionsPermissions

Cette vue ne donne pas une vue complète des autorisations pour le principal actuel.This view does not give a complete view of permissions for the current principal. L'utilisateur doit également vérifier si le principal est un membre de rôles et de groupes auxquels des autorisations sont affectées.The user must also check whether the principal is a member of roles and groups that have permissions assigned.